Barracks

Barracks is where Masked of Dantea as a faction train and keep their soldiers, ready for most emergencies.

General layout:

The structure, made out of stone or clay bricks covered in plaster, starts out as an L corridor. On the right is the entrance to the dining hall, which connects to the kitchen. On the left are several large room filled with 2-story beds, where the soldiers sleep.
As the corridor continues past the recreation area and toilets, it ends with a set of rooms, for the Commander ranks, including the operation hall. Outside lays the training field, a large open area, and a military obstacle course.

Rooms:


Dining hall:

The dining hall is a large room filled with chairs and tables. Each table has a basket of bread and cups of spices, usually just salt. Soldiers eat here and some spend their free time.

Kitchen:

Accessed from the dining hall, it is a room filled with stoves, cauldrons and basically everything needed to prepare meals for the soldiers.

Recreation hall:

Recreation hall is a larger room fields with tables, chairs and training equipment such as dummies or weights. Soldiers tend to bring their own stuff such as cards here, so the room gets filed with a tons of games and training equipment. Because it can't house all soldiers at once, large number of them stay outside during their downtime.

Bathroom:

A set of smaller rooms with small bathtubs that are filled with water and a few latrines. The room tends to smell of sweat and shit, but it is needed with a large number of soldiers. Tho they tend to bath in lakes, rivers and the sea, as it is more convenient.

Bedrooms:

Each barracks tends to have several of them. Each has a bed an a chest for 20 soldiers, with a table and a chair in the corner. The room is used only to sleep and store stuff, as it is rather tight in terms of space.

Office:

The office is a smaller room with a few desks, chairs and a lot of shelves for things like paperwork, which Commander ranks do here.

Commander chambers:

Made for Commander ranks, these chambers include a separate set of latrines, bathtubs and bedrooms for each commander.

Operation hall:

A large room with maps, figure and all sorts of plans. Commander ranks plan their strategies here during emergencies such as war. There is a huge map on a table at the center, where they set figure and keep track of their soldiers and draw out possible moves.

Armory:

Armory is a smaller secure room filled with swords, bows, a rows, shields and armors. Basically all the equipment the soldiers need. Usually at least 4 soldiers keep guard, as the equipment costs a lot of money.

Training field:

The outside flat location is used to do all sorts of training, from simple workouts to duels between soldiers. There is a small podium next to it, where a high ranking military official stands when making announcements.

Obstacle course:

Walls, mud pits, tunnels, logs, etc. As many obstacles as possible packed into one hell. Soldiers train here for tougher environments, or to just better their physique.

Additional information:


Defenses:

The barracks are guarded by soldiers on shifts, day and night. There is usually at least 15 of them guarding at any time.
